Southeast Technical College law enforcement program reports enrollment growth, high reciprocity pass rates

Summary

Instructors told the board the two-year law enforcement program is expanding hands-on training with simulators and partnerships with local agencies, and reported high reciprocity pass rates that help graduates qualify for agency hiring; the board acknowledged the update.

Skip Miller and Keith (identified in the transcript as "Keith, Greece") presented an update on the two-year law enforcement program at Southeast Technical College, describing curriculum, field partnerships and new training technology. "We both are retired captains from the Sioux Falls Police Department," Miller said, explaining the instructors bring recent field experience to the classroom.
